Indiana. 6-24-3 Notice is hereby giv.n that the Board of School Trustees of the School City of Fast Chicago. Indiana, proposes to incur sn indebtedness of One Hundred 1'fty Thousand Dollars for the erection of a high school building at the comer of Hemlock and 140 h Streets. said building to be approximately 91x140 feet, two stories and basement containing twenty-three recitation rooms, to be constructed of br'Ck and stone, and to cost approximately Tuo Hundred Fourteen Thousand Dollfirs for the cost of which, it will be necessary to issue bonds in the sum of One Hundred Fifty Thousand rol'ars. the ba',am! thereof to be obtained from currcy revenue. J. H. ROSS. Presr W. B. VAN HORNE, Treas. J. C. DICKSON, Sec. Trustees School City of East Chicago. June 14th. 131S. June 19-26 July 3 NOTICE TO XON-RESI DENT ' STATE OR INDIANA. LAKE COl'NTT. Venezuela Sparsely Populated. The area of the republic r,t Venezuela Is 1,020. 400 square kil. misters O .- P7(i square rrci!e0 nnd the CJilninvrl population on December 81. K16, -.-824,034. This population is centered la the coastal and mountain .list-lets. The states of Acpure and Bolivar an 1 the Deltft-Amacuro and Amaronas territories, with an arerafje population of 0.3 per sqtiare kilometer, are amon? the most Hcnntily Inhabited districts tn the world.
